They're not from our site, but you may have "picked up" some nasties on your computer. If you don't have spyware and anti-virus software, you should probably go to a site that offers a free diagnostic and then check the Computer Talk forum for recommendations on what to consider buying and installing.

Also, I've found using Mozilla as my browser (rather than Internet Explorer) has dramatically reduced the incident of popups.

If you have Windows 2000 or XP there is a "feature" included which allows pop-up's to appear on your PC even if you're not connected to the Internet. See this link for instructions on how to disable it, for perhaps that will help: http://davesgarden.com/journal/j/viewentry/29784/

I agree with these folks about Mozilla browsers - they rock. I use Firefox 1.0 and love how there's even extensions (like plug-in's) available to block Macromedia Flash ads. Their e-mail client Thunderbird is top-notch, too. http://mozilla.org
